complete verse (Job 27:6)

Following are a number of back-translations as well as a sample translation for translators of Job 27:6:

  • Kupsabiny: “I shall always say that I am righteous,
    and I have no anxiety/worry at all.” (Source: Kupsabiny Back Translation)
  • Newari: “I will maintain my righteousness,
    as long as I live my conscience will not accuse me.” (Source: Newari Back Translation)
  • Hiligaynon: “I will-defend/[lit. stand-up] that I am righteous, and I will- never -stop. As long as I live my conscience is clean.” (Source: Hiligaynon Back Translation)
  • English: “I will say that I am innocent, and never say anything different/change what I say;
    my conscience will never reproach me as long as I live.” (Source: Translation for Translators)
